'Very sad thing': Trump reacts to the death of two military troops in Jordan; here's what we know about the attack
New Delhi, July 19 -- Hours after two US military personnel were killed and one was reportedly missing in Jordan following Iranian strikes, US President Donald Trump on Saturday (local time) called the deaths a "very sad thing."
He made these remarks to NewsNation and said the two troops died "in service of our country" and reiterated that the war's key objective is "never allowing Iran to have a nuclear weapon."
Trump's remarks came after the US Central Command (CENTCOM) announced the deaths of the service members, in an incident that marked the first American military facilities to be hit by Iranian fire since March.
